Template:Infobox Template:Tocright Adventurer Experience consists of Experience Points (XP) that accumulate in the adventurer pool, and can subsequently be can be used to raise Adventurer Skills.

The Adventurer XP is initially stored in your Adventurer Experience Pool (which can be seen by opening the Skills Window, and then clicking the "Adventuring" tab).

As you learn Adventurer Skills (i.e. raise the level of these skills), the XP is transferred from the adventure pool and into the skills being learned. XP in the adventurer pool can only be applied toward increasing Adventurer Skills.

Skill advancement requires the availability of Pooled Experience. A mage who spends all day throwing fireballs at training dummies will eventually find they have depleted their Pooled Adventurer Experience and be unable to further advance Adventurer skills. Your available pooled Experience for Adventuring and Production skills is displayed in the bottom-right of the appropriate skills tab.[1]

Bonuses to Adventurer Experience

As a bonus, every day that you log into Shroud of the Avatar will earn the characters you play 10,000 experience points for the initial character and 2,500 for each additional character on the same account. These points will be added to the shared pooled adventuring XP.[1]

Avatars that elect to play with others will receive additional bonuses to experience received from combat. Players that play in Open Mode will receive an additional 10% to combat experience received.[1]

players that are flagged for PvP while in Open mode will receive a bonus 25%[2] to combat experience that stacks with their Open mode bonus. There is no bonus for being flagged for PvP in any mode other than Open.[1]

Do note that the above bonuses only apply to Adventurer Experience gained from combat. They do not apply to Producer Experience, or to Adventurer Experience gained from other soruces.

Current Available Adventurer Experience Pool

You can view your current Adventurer Experience pool total at any time by pressing the default k key that will bring up the Skills Window. Click on the Adventuring tab located at the left side of this window. At the bottom of this window will be a display named Pooled Experience. The value shown here is the amount of currently available Adventurer Experience that can be used to level up Adventurer Skills.

You can also type the /xp command in the Chat Window. This will output the currently available Pooled Adventurer Experience (Character), Pooled Adventurer Experience (Shared), and Pooled Adventurer Experience (Total).

Types of Adventurer Experience Pools

There are three different types of Adventurer Experience pools:

  • Pooled Adventurer Experience (Character)
    • This XP value is what the current active character has available to them. This XP value is only on this one specific currently active character.
  • Pooled Adventurer Experience (Shared)
    • This XP value is what the current active character as well as any other characters on the same Account have available to them.
  • Pooled Adventurer Experience (Total)
    • This XP value is a combination of the character and shared pools currently available to the active character.

Trivia

  • Experience was added in Release 11, but only for combat. In Release 12, experience for quests was added.
